Placement Experience

4

The students become eligible for placements after their sixth semester. Many companies visit PEC some of the top recruiters are Uber,Microsoft,JP Morgan,Goldman Sachs,Texas Instruments,Cisco,American Express and many more. This year the highest package was 61 lpa given to 3 students from circuital branches,6 students received offer of 52 lpa. The average CTC was 13.6 lpa and specifically about ECE it was 15.6 lpa. 456 out of 694 students were placed which is a placement rate of 65.7% including PPOs from companies. Fees and Financial Aid

1. Institute Academic Fees a)Caution money: 8000(refundable) b)One time fees: 11,000 c)Academic fees(per semester): 94,000 In first semester you have to pay some extra fees as security and second semester onwards 94,000. 2. Hostel Fees and Charges a)Caution money: 6000(refundable) b)Hostel charges: 72,000 c)Mess charges:3500(per month) Approximately 1,30,000 per year for hostel stay and mess. 3. Scholarships and Fee Waivers a)Merit based scholarships b)Category based scholarships For more details about scholarships you can contact DAA(Dean Academic Affairs) in the college. So for a general category student the approximate cost including hostel and mess facilities will be approximately 3.7-3.9 lacs per annum.

Campus Life

4

The biggest event in PEC is PECFEST which is held in november which is one of the largest fests of north India. Apart from this TechFest is also held which includes coding hackathons,robotics and startt up pitches. There are many clubs and societies which manage these events. There are a lot of books and journals in the library and they are easily accessible for students. Classrooms are given all facilities like digital boards,ACs and high speed wifi. Labs are also equipped with equipments needed for learning. There are many sports like cricket,football,volleyball,basketball,badminton.lawn tennis and courts are also provided for the same. Extracurriculur activities like dance,music,photography have their respected clubs. Their are many clubs and societies run by students whoch build leadership skills,teamwork and social interaction.

Hostel Facilities

3

In first year double sharing rooms are provide with fan,lights,2 chairs and 1 table and 2 beds with almirah provide in the room. From second year single room is also provided. Mess meal quality is decent not very good but is is eatable nothing can beat home cooked food. Registration of hostel is done in hostel only , shivalik hostel is provided in first year. There are many local PGs nearby like sector 15 or sector 11 if you don't want to stay in hostel.

Admission

According to my JEE mains rank the colleges I applied , PEC was the best among them and also chandigarh is a very good location and also not very far away from my home. this was the reason to choose PEC because it was the best i got according to my rank. Pec accepts students based on JEE mains score, students participate in JOSSA and CSAB counselling.A additional criteria of 75% or more in board or top 20 %ile is also taken into account. I think this year cutoff for ECE other state would be 20,000 rank approximately i am not sure about it.

Night Life

4

Gym closes at 8pm,library is open for 9am to 8pm on working days and during exam days library is open upto 12am at night. Boys in timing is 10pm but is not very strict you can enjoy night life in chandigarh guards are friendly in case of boys but girls have strict in time of 9pm. Outside college some famous spots are sector 11 market,sukhna lake etc. yes locality is safe to roam around
